12еместо

31

голос

Объединять теги

Дабы сделать, наконец, нормальную и полезную систему, а не чтобы было. Идея такова, реализовать систему, где юзеры могут приводить разные похожие теги к одному. Например, видит юзер тег «линукс», а сам использует «linux», и он говорит системе, что это на самом-то деле одно и то же. Или «линупс» и «линукс». В итоге, образуются пары идентичных тегов, если за такие пары наберётся достаточное количество голосов, победивший тег автоматически (и впредь!) заменяется повсеместно. В случае цепочек (когда предлагается слить тег А и Б, а потом Б и В, а также Г и А и Д и Б), все теги объединяются в семантическую единицу и выставляются на общее голосование. При превышении определённого порога (например, в 50 голосов) в голосовании за одну пару, она унифицируется в победителя, а вхождения в другие пары заменяются на этого победителя. Например, в приведённом выше примере в группе Б и В победил В (и у всех, кто использовал тег Б, он заменился на В). Тогда остаются пары А и В, Г и А, Д и В, набранные голоса сбрасываются, чтобы выбор был вновь непредвзят. Эти пары вновь соревнуются, и так до полной безоговорочной победы одного тега. Горячие пары (от 10 голосов, скажем) можно выводить на главную и предлагать голосовать всем.

Суть системы в том, чтобы теги реально помогали искать информацию, сейчас они просто украшают псто и помогают понять, о чём речь. Посмотрите на хабр, пиздец же полный.

eurekafag, 06.12.2010, 14:13
Статус идеи: ожидает рассмотрения

Комментарии

@xaos, 06.12.2010, 19:01
Очень спорный момент. Заменять одни теги другими точно нельзя. Но в качестве упрощения поиска, можно сделать на странице сообщений по определенному тегу дополнительный блок "Похожие теги", по которым можно пощелкать и найти что нужно.
qwerty, 07.12.2010, 18:56
я подозреваю, что речь идет об

"Anime" - "Аниме"
"Cinema" - "Кино"
"Movie" - "Фильм" - "Фильмы"

не вижу ничего плохого в замене
@xaos, 07.12.2010, 19:07
а я вот часто использую "кино" в качестве "movie". И не хочу чтобы оно заменялось на "cinema".
eurekafag, 06.12.2010, 20:28
Можно и так. Но структуризация и предложения лучших уникальных тегов необходимы как воздух. Равно как и отбор с использованием логических операторов (то, что делается на раз-два с помощью SELECT INTERSECT/UNION и т.п., но что не осилил угнич). Также можно советовать юзерам поменять теги, в общем-то, я тоже против насилия. Но если юзер использует тег, который не признаёт большинство, стоит ему об этом намекнуть. А также дать возможность массово заменять и объединять теги самостоятельно. Это, разумеется, не первой важности дело, но я был бы искренне рад видеть такую возможность здесь. Хотя бы потому, что такого ещё нигде не видел, но джва года хочу.
@SilverDragon, 12.12.2010, 06:17
Можно сделать так: система тегов как таковая остается без изменений, блок "похожие теги", пополняющийся юзерскими идеями (то же голосование), а если человек использует какой-то тег, который уже есть в облаке похожих, но не самый популярный, ему приходит извещение, что, мол, большинство юзеров юзают тег такой-то вместо такого-то. Или не извещения, а какой-нить раздел либо на сайтеце, либо спец. команда у бота, которая позволит оценить свои теги по такой системе и при желании юзера массово поменять теги в своем бложике
qwerty, 07.12.2010, 18:52
Боже, благослови твою светлую голову!
eurekafag, 07.12.2010, 19:17
**Обмазался благословлением и подрочил**

Спасибо ^^ Вообще, я слабо понимаю назначение тегов в коллективных блогах. Ну ладно там ещё сам ведёшь, придумал теги и не отклоняешься от них, но ведь в сообществах с сотнями людей у каждого они свои. Полноценных выборок по всему сообществу не сделать, искать по каждому юзеру, учитывая его теги? Да ну на хрен. Проще использовать поиск (который тоже часто лажает, т.к. нормально протегировать всё равно может только человек, вникающий в контекст и медиа-содержимое), но тогда суть тегов полностью теряется.

Кстати, подобная система оценок-унификации вполне может стать отдельным небольшим проектом для подключения к другим коллективным блогам. Причём, режимы замена_всем-помощь_ищущему-помощь_писателю также можно ввести переключаемыми администратором всего сайта.
nextus, 08.12.2010, 00:37
> При превышении определённого порога (например, в 50 голосов) …
заведомый фейл. Пусть каждый пользователь сам для себя решает, какие теги ему видеть одинаковыми, а какие — нет. Нахуй мне сдалось это ваше навязанное мнение большинства?
eurekafag, 08.12.2010, 09:06
Ну я же уже п̶р̶и̶н̶ё̶с̶ ̶с̶во̶и̶ ̶и̶з̶в̶и̶н̶е̶н̶и̶я̶!̶ предложил другие варианты!

Оставить комментарий